Jessie Magdaleno (22-0, 16 KOs) ended matters early in the February 20, 2016 edition of UniMas' Solo Boxeo with a seventh-round knockout of Rey Perez (20-7, 5 KOs) at the Celebrity Theater in Pheonix Arizona.
On Saturday, February 20, 2016, Felix Sturm (40-5-3, 18 KOs) became the first German fighter to win a fifth world title by defeating Fedor Chudinov (14-1, 10 KOs) in a rematch of their May 2015 fight.
